The battery life of rechargeable e-cigarettes varies significantly depending on brand, model and battery capacity. Mainstream products usually meet daily usage needs, while some high-end models support long battery life or fast charging functions. The following is the specific analysis:
First, the core influencing factors of battery life
Battery capacity
The battery capacity of mainstream products ranges from 350mAh to 1800mAh. The larger the capacity, the stronger the battery life. For example:
The Platypus e-cigarette is equipped with a 530mAh battery and supports approximately 4000 pups.
A certain product of Relx is equipped with a 1800mAh battery, which can support approximately 18,000 suction ports, meeting the all-weather usage requirements.
Some high-end models (such as the Relx Zeus Frontier) are equipped with a 400mAh battery and achieve higher performance output through optimized circuit design.
Usage frequency and suction habits
Light users (with a daily suction frequency of no more than 50 times) can support a battery life of 2 to 3 days.
Heavy users (with a daily suction frequency of ≥100 times) need to charge daily, but fast charging technologies (such as Type-C interface) can reduce the charging time to 30-60 minutes.
Standby performance
High-quality products have low standby power consumption. For instance, a certain model of Relx can maintain battery power for up to 72 hours in standby mode, making it suitable for short-term business trips.

Third, technologies for enhancing battery life
Low-power circuit design
By optimizing the chip algorithm to reduce standby power consumption, for instance, the standby power consumption of Relx products is 30% lower than that of traditional models.
Intelligent power management
Some high-end models are equipped with display screens (such as the 1.77-inch smart animated screen of the ELF BAR AF5000), which show the remaining battery power and the number of suctions in real time.
Battery material upgrade
The lifespan of lithium-ion batteries can reach 1 to 2 years. Although nickel-metal-hydride batteries have a shorter lifespan (6 to 12 months), they support more charging cycles (≥500 times).
